'' At the moment the fairy set up a screech so frightful that the mare took fright and she off with herself up hte road Gerry was soon after her. Having got up to her he led her home. A year went by and when the fair was on again Gerry was at it as usual. When he was returning home again he caught the fairy, and the fairy told him that he would find the gold in the three - cornered field at home. Gerry went home well pleased. He went to the field and he dug up the croak. But he was not able to lift it. He went to get his wife but when he returned he found thousand and one sticks and no gold
